function Tree(obj) {
this.cnt = 1;
this.obj = obj || {children:[]};
this.indexes = {};
this.build(this.obj);
}
var proto = Tree.prototype;
proto.build = function(obj) {
var indexes = this.indexes;
var startId = this.cnt;
var self = this;
var index = {id: startId, node: obj};
indexes[this.cnt+''] = index;
this.cnt++;
if(obj.children && obj.children.length) walk(obj.children, index);
function walk(objs, parent) {
var children = [];
objs.forEach(function(obj, i) {
var index = {};
index.id = self.cnt;
index.node = obj;
if(parent) index.parent = parent.id;
indexes[self.cnt+''] = index;
children.push(self.cnt);
self.cnt++;
if(obj.children && obj.children.length) walk(obj.children, index);
});
parent.children = children;
children.forEach(function(id, i) {
var index = indexes[id+''];
if(i > 0) index.prev = children[i-1];
if(i < children.length-1) index.next = children[i+1];
});
}
return index;
};
proto.getIndex = function(id) {
var index = this.indexes[id+''];
if(index) return index;
};
proto.removeIndex = function(index) {
var self = this;
del(index);
function del(index) {
delete self.indexes[index.id+''];
if(index.children && index.children.length) {
index.children.forEach(function(child) {
del(self.getIndex(child));
});
}
}
};
proto.get = function(id) {
var index = this.getIndex(id);
if(index && index.node) return index.node;
return null;
};
proto.remove = function(id) {
var index = this.getIndex(id);
var node = this.get(id);
var parentIndex = this.getIndex(index.parent);
var parentNode = this.get(index.parent);
parentNode.children.splice(parentNode.children.indexOf(node), 1);
parentIndex.children.splice(parentIndex.children.indexOf(id), 1);
this.removeIndex(index);
this.updateChildren(parentIndex.children);
return node;
};
proto.updateChildren = function(children) {
children.forEach(function(id, i) {
var index = this.getIndex(id);
index.prev = index.next = null;
if(i > 0) index.prev = children[i-1];
if(i < children.length-1) index.next = children[i+1];
}.bind(this));
};
proto.insert = function(obj, parentId, i) {
var parentIndex = this.getIndex(parentId);
var parentNode = this.get(parentId);
var index = this.build(obj);
index.parent = parentId;
parentNode.children = parentNode.children || [];
parentIndex.children = parentIndex.children || [];
parentNode.children.splice(i, 0, obj);
parentIndex.children.splice(i, 0, index.id);
this.updateChildren(parentIndex.children);
if(parentIndex.parent) {
this.updateChildren(this.getIndex(parentIndex.parent).children);
}
return index;
};
proto.insertBefore = function(obj, destId) {
var destIndex = this.getIndex(destId);
var parentId = destIndex.parent;
var i = this.getIndex(parentId).children.indexOf(destId);
return this.insert(obj, parentId, i);
};
proto.insertAfter = function(obj, destId) {
var destIndex = this.getIndex(destId);
var parentId = destIndex.parent;
var i = this.getIndex(parentId).children.indexOf(destId);
return this.insert(obj, parentId, i+1);
};
proto.prepend = function(obj, destId) {
return this.insert(obj, destId, 0);
};
proto.append = function(obj, destId) {
var destIndex = this.getIndex(destId);
destIndex.children = destIndex.children || [];
return this.insert(obj, destId, destIndex.children.length);
};
module.exports = Tree;
